Let me explain a bit more what I need.. first of all the dataset I have has around 20K users. From 1 timestamp up to 10+ timestamps, and someone can start from level 1 and become level 5.
The endresults will look as follows :
| Country | Level 1 | Level 2 | Level 3 | Level 4 | Level 5 | Column Total |
| United Kingdom | 1000 | 500 | 200 | 500 | 1234 | 3434 |
| United States | 500 | 300 | 100 | 1000 | 3254 | 5154 |
| Japan | 300 | 200 | 300 | 100 | 6549 | 7449 |
| Germany | 200 | 100 | 100 | 5123 | 9477 | 15000 |
| Rows Total | 2000 | 1100 | 700 | 6723 | 20514 | 31037 |
The country exist in another table (unique based on customerID, so that not an issue)
Level 1,2,3,4,5 and Total - Columns would be DAX measures
Column Total = Level 1 + 2+3+4+5
Rows Total = Level Dax Formula count

In my actual data is a timestamp dd/mm/yyyy hh:mm:ss.
In the sample I meant to have dd/mm/yyyy, but from what I see now the I have 1 not valid date for CustomerID 1111 as 10/18/2023 instead of 18/10/2023. The rest are ok.
For Level 4 is 0 because on the last entry(timestamp) of customerID 4444 he is on Level 5.
I believe my main issue here is that not the actual count, but how to make make a summarize table with only the last date for each customer ID as follows :
CustomerID Timestamp Level 1111 18/10/2023 Level 2 2222 01/04/2023 Level 1 3333 05/08/2023 Level 3 4444 03/05/2023 Level 5 5555 05/07/2023 Level 2 If I have this table (as a temporary table in a measure), the count part is simple.
